MT Manager v2.15.3版本的 MD5 值为:34ea5286e529d87838c6cae0a2220d93

以下内容为反编译后的 C12136.java 源代码,内容仅作参考


package l;

import com.alipay.sdk.app.OpenAuthTask;
import java.io.IOException;
import java.io.UnsupportedEncodingException;
import java.net.InetAddress;
import java.net.UnknownHostException;
import java.security.SecureRandom;
import java.util.ArrayList;
import java.util.Arrays;
import java.util.HashMap;
import java.util.HashSet;
import java.util.TimeZone;

public class C12136 implements InterfaceC6710 {

    public static final InterfaceC3862 f35587 = C2178.m6404(C12136.class);

    public int f35588;

    public boolean f35589;

    public EnumC7552 f35590;

    public int f35591;

    public int f35592;

    public String f35593;

    public int f35594;

    public byte[] f35595;

    public boolean f35596;

    public InetAddress f35597;

    public int f35598;

    public int f35599;

    public int f35600;

    public long f35601;

    public HashSet f35602;

    public int f35603;

    public int f35604;

    public String f35605;

    public int f35606;

    public boolean f35607;

    public TimeZone f35608;

    public ArrayList f35609;

    public int f35610;

    public EnumC7552 f35611;

    public int f35612;

    public long f35613;

    public String f35614;

    public int f35615;

    public String f35616;

    public int f35617;

    public int f35618;

    public int f35619;

    public int f35620;

    public int f35621;

    public boolean f35622;

    public String f35623;

    public InetAddress[] f35624;

    public boolean f35625;

    public int f35626;

    public int f35627;

    public int f35628;

    public int f35629;

    public boolean f35630;

    public int f35631;

    public int f35632;

    public int f35633;

    public SecureRandom f35634;

    public final TimeZone m25938() {
        return this.f35608;
    }

    public final int m25939() {
        return this.f35594;
    }

    public final EnumC7552 m25940() {
        return this.f35590;
    }

    public final int m25941() {
        return this.f35604;
    }

    public final int m25942() {
        return this.f35610;
    }

    public final String m25943() {
        return this.f35614;
    }

    public final int m25944() {
        return this.f35618;
    }

    public final int m25945() {
        return this.f35628;
    }

    public final int m25946() {
        return this.f35615;
    }

    public final long m25947() {
        return this.f35601;
    }

    public final EnumC7552 m25949() {
        return this.f35611;
    }

    public final int m25950() {
        return this.f35627;
    }

    public final int m25951() {
        return this.f35598;
    }

    public final int m25952() {
        return this.f35629;
    }

    public final long m25953() {
        return this.f35613;
    }

    public final int m25954() {
        return this.f35603;
    }

    public final boolean m25955() {
        return this.f35625;
    }

    public final String m25956() {
        return this.f35616;
    }

    public final int m25957() {
        return this.f35617;
    }

    public final boolean m25958() {
        return this.f35596;
    }

    public final byte[] m25959() {
        return this.f35595;
    }

    public final ArrayList m25960() {
        return this.f35609;
    }

    public final InetAddress m25961() {
        return this.f35597;
    }

    public final String m25962() {
        return this.f35593;
    }

    public final int m25963() {
        return this.f35621;
    }

    public final int m25964() {
        return this.f35592;
    }

    public final int m25965() {
        return this.f35631;
    }

    public final InetAddress[] m25966() {
        return this.f35624;
    }

    public final int m25967() {
        return this.f35633;
    }

    public final String m25968() {
        return this.f35623;
    }

    public final boolean m25969() {
        return this.f35607;
    }

    public final String m25970() {
        return this.f35605;
    }

    public final int m25971() {
        return this.f35606;
    }

    public final boolean m25972() {
        return this.f35589;
    }

    public final int m25973() {
        return this.f35599;
    }

    public final int m25974() {
        return this.f35588;
    }

    public final int m25975() {
        return this.f35619;
    }

    public final int m25976() {
        return this.f35626;
    }

    public final boolean m25977() {
        return this.f35622;
    }

    public final int m25978() {
        return this.f35600;
    }

    public final int m25979() {
        return this.f35632;
    }

    public final int m25980() {
        return this.f35591;
    }

    public final int m25981() {
        return this.f35620;
    }

    public final boolean m25982() {
        return this.f35630;
    }

    public final int m25983() {
        return this.f35612;
    }

    public final SecureRandom m25984() {
        return this.f35634;
    }

    static {
        new HashMap().put("TreeConnectAndX.QueryInformation", 0);
    }

    public final boolean m25948(String str) {
        if (this.f35602 == null) {
            return true;
        }
        return !r0.contains(str);
    }

    public C12136() {
        this(false);
    }

    public C12136(boolean z) {
        new HashMap();
        this.f35588 = -1;
        this.f35607 = true;
        this.f35622 = true;
        this.f35633 = 3;
        this.f35625 = true;
        this.f35630 = true;
        this.f35623 = "Cp850";
        this.f35619 = 0;
        this.f35592 = 0;
        this.f35629 = 250;
        this.f35615 = 30000;
        this.f35627 = 35000;
        this.f35591 = 35000;
        this.f35604 = 35000;
        this.f35628 = 10;
        this.f35632 = 65535;
        this.f35594 = 65535;
        this.f35593 = "jCIFS";
        this.f35618 = 1;
        this.f35613 = 300L;
        this.f35631 = 36000;
        this.f35617 = OpenAuthTask.Duplex;
        this.f35606 = 576;
        this.f35620 = 576;
        this.f35603 = 2;
        this.f35626 = 3000;
        this.f35624 = new InetAddress[0];
        this.f35598 = 65536;
        this.f35621 = 65023;
        this.f35610 = 16;
        this.f35612 = 65435;
        this.f35599 = 200;
        this.f35601 = 5000L;
        this.f35600 = 2;
        this.f35589 = true;
        this.f35596 = true;
        this.f35616 = "GUEST";
        this.f35605 = "";
        if (z) {
            try {
                "".getBytes("Cp850");
                this.f35588 = (int) (Math.random() * 65536.0d);
                this.f35608 = TimeZone.getDefault();
                SecureRandom secureRandom = new SecureRandom();
                this.f35634 = secureRandom;
                if (this.f35595 == null) {
                    byte[] bArr = new byte[32];
                    secureRandom.nextBytes(bArr);
                    this.f35595 = bArr;
                }
                if (this.f35614 == null) {
                    this.f35614 = System.getProperty("os.name");
                }
                if (this.f35619 == 0) {
                    this.f35619 = 51203;
                }
                if (this.f35592 == 0) {
                    this.f35592 = -2147434412;
                }
                if (this.f35597 == null) {
                    try {
                        this.f35597 = InetAddress.getByName("255.255.255.255");
                    } catch (UnknownHostException e) {
                        f35587.mo10288("Failed to get broadcast address", (Exception) e);
                    }
                }
                if (this.f35609 == null) {
                    ArrayList arrayList = new ArrayList();
                    this.f35609 = arrayList;
                    EnumC1658 enumC1658 = EnumC1658.f5274;
                    EnumC1658 enumC16582 = EnumC1658.f5277;
                    EnumC1658 enumC16583 = EnumC1658.f5276;
                    EnumC1658 enumC16584 = EnumC1658.f5278;
                    if (this.f35624.length == 0) {
                        arrayList.add(enumC16584);
                        this.f35609.add(enumC16582);
                        this.f35609.add(enumC16583);
                    } else {
                        arrayList.add(enumC16584);
                        this.f35609.add(enumC16582);
                        this.f35609.add(enumC1658);
                        this.f35609.add(enumC16583);
                    }
                }
                if (this.f35611 == null || this.f35590 == null) {
                    EnumC7552 enumC7552 = EnumC7552.f21473;
                    this.f35611 = enumC7552;
                    EnumC7552 enumC75522 = EnumC7552.f21470;
                    this.f35590 = enumC75522;
                    if (enumC7552.m18217(enumC75522)) {
                        this.f35590 = this.f35611;
                    }
                }
                if (this.f35602 == null) {
                    this.f35602 = new HashSet(Arrays.asList("Smb2SessionSetupRequest", "Smb2TreeConnectRequest"));
                }
            } catch (UnsupportedEncodingException unused) {
                throw new IOException("The default OEM encoding Cp850 does not appear to be supported by this JRE.");
            }
        }
    }
}